Tasks:

  • Coordinate logistics and materials for trade shows and marketing events, including registration, travel, booth assets, promotional items, and vendor management to ensure all event components are prepared, delivered, and executed seamlessly
  • Manage event timelines and maintain documentation of plans, deliverables, and assets in order to keep deadlines and information organized and accessible
  • Research and evaluate new industry events and sponsorship opportunities to help identify high impact initiatives aligned with business goals
  • Assist with coordination and submission of speaker applications and leadership opportunities to support expert visibility at key industry events
  • Support planning and execution of company-hosted events to ensure internal and partner facing experiences run smoothly and meet strategic objectives
  • Coordinate cross functional communication between internal departments and external vendors to maintain alignment on responsibilities and timelines
  • Assist with attendee communications, registration processes, and post-event follow-up to provide participants with timely information and continued engagement
  • Monitor event KPIs, lead capture processes, and budgets, and compile post-event summaries to ensure performance measurement and data-informed decision-making
  • Coordinate scheduling of internal talent for marketing shoots and promotional initiatives to keep content organized and completed on time
  • Maintain inventory of event materials and ensure marketing assets are produced and delivered on schedule to support brand consistency and readiness
  • Maintain updates to the website including press releases, articles, awards, and timeline updates to ensure accurate, current, and brand-aligned public facing content
